pkgsrc-Changes-HG arch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
[pkgsrc/trunk]: pkgsrc/textproc user-destdir support
details: https://anonhg.NetBSD.org/pkgsrc/rev/eaaf030e1c74
branches: trunk
changeset: 561243:eaaf030e1c74
user: joerg <joerg%pkgsrc.org@localhost>
date: Tue Jul 07 22:12:02 2009 +0000
description:
user-destdir support
diffstat:
textproc/diffsplit/Makefile | 8 ++++++--
textproc/docbook-website/Makefile | 17 +++++++++--------
textproc/gdome2/Makefile | 6 ++++--
3 files changed, 19 insertions(+), 12 deletions(-)
diffs (96 lines):
diff -r 860958924902 -r eaaf030e1c74 textproc/diffsplit/Makefile
--- a/textproc/diffsplit/Makefile Tue Jul 07 22:10:57 2009 +0000
+++ b/textproc/diffsplit/Makefile Tue Jul 07 22:12:02 2009 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.1.1.1 2007/03/13 16:03:08 ginsbach Exp $
+# $NetBSD: Makefile,v 1.2 2009/07/07 22:12:32 joerg Exp $
# FreeBSD Id: ports/textproc/diffsplit/Makefile,v 1.7 2006/12/22 13:43:54 barner Exp
DISTNAME= diffsplit
@@ -13,15 +13,19 @@
HOMEPAGE= http://www.pathname.com/~quinlan/software/diffsplit/
COMMENT= Splits a unified diff into pieces which patch one file each
+PKG_DESTDIR_SUPPORT= user-destdir
+
NO_BUILD= YES
WRKSRC= ${WRKDIR}
REPLACE_PERL= diffsplit
USE_TOOLS+= perl:run
+INSTALLATION_DIRS= bin
+
do-extract:
${CP} ${DISTDIR}/${DIST_SUBDIR}/diffsplit ${WRKDIR}
do-install:
- ${INSTALL_SCRIPT} ${WRKDIR}/diffsplit ${PREFIX}/bin
+ ${INSTALL_SCRIPT} ${WRKDIR}/diffsplit ${DESTDIR}${PREFIX}/bin
.include "../../mk/bsd.pkg.mk"
diff -r 860958924902 -r eaaf030e1c74 textproc/docbook-website/Makefile
--- a/textproc/docbook-website/Makefile Tue Jul 07 22:10:57 2009 +0000
+++ b/textproc/docbook-website/Makefile Tue Jul 07 22:12:02 2009 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.25 2008/05/26 02:13:24 joerg Exp $
+# $NetBSD: Makefile,v 1.26 2009/07/07 22:12:02 joerg Exp $
#
DISTNAME= docbook-website-2.6.0
@@ -10,6 +10,8 @@
HOMEPAGE= http://docbook.sourceforge.net/
COMMENT= DocBook XML DTD for building websites
+PKG_DESTDIR_SUPPORT= user-destdir
+
DEPENDS+= docbook-simple-[0-9]*:../../textproc/docbook-simple
DEPENDS+= docbook-xsl>=1.58:../../textproc/docbook-xsl
@@ -25,18 +27,17 @@
XML_CATALOGS= ${DTDDIR}/catalog.xml
SGML_CATALOGS= ${DTDDIR}/catalog
+INSTALLATION_DIRS= ${DOCDIR} ${DTDDIR} ${EGDIR}
+
do-install:
cd ${WRKSRC} && ${FIND} . -name "*.orig" -exec ${RM} {} \;
- ${INSTALL_DATA_DIR} ${DOCDIR}
- ${INSTALL_DATA_DIR} ${DTDDIR}
- ${INSTALL_DATA_DIR} ${EGDIR}
cd ${WRKSRC} && pax -rwpm ChangeLog README VERSION \
RELEASE-NOTES.html RELEASE-NOTES.txt RELEASE-NOTES.xml \
- TODO ${DOCDIR}
- cd ${WRKSRC}/example && pax -rwpm . ${EGDIR}
+ TODO ${DESTDIR}${DOCDIR}
+ cd ${WRKSRC}/example && pax -rwpm . ${DESTDIR}${EGDIR}
cd ${WRKSRC} && pax -rwpm VERSION extensions schema xsl \
- ${DTDDIR}
- ${INSTALL_DATA} ${WRKSRC}/catalog.xml ${WRKSRC}/catalog ${DTDDIR}
+ ${DESTDIR}${DTDDIR}
+ ${INSTALL_DATA} ${WRKSRC}/catalog.xml ${WRKSRC}/catalog ${DESTDIR}${DTDDIR}
.include "../../textproc/xmlcatmgr/catalogs.mk"
.include "../../mk/bsd.pkg.mk"
diff -r 860958924902 -r eaaf030e1c74 textproc/gdome2/Makefile
--- a/textproc/gdome2/Makefile Tue Jul 07 22:10:57 2009 +0000
+++ b/textproc/gdome2/Makefile Tue Jul 07 22:12:02 2009 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.7 2006/02/05 23:11:02 joerg Exp $
+# $NetBSD: Makefile,v 1.8 2009/07/07 22:14:56 joerg Exp $
DISTNAME= gdome2-0.8.1
PKGREVISION= 2
@@ -9,10 +9,12 @@
HOMEPAGE= http://gdome2.cs.unibo.it/
COMMENT= Gnome DOM (Document Object Model) engine
+PKG_DESTDIR_SUPPORT= user-destdir
+
USE_LIBTOOL= yes
USE_TOOLS+= pkg-config
GNU_CONFIGURE= yes
-CONFIGURE_ARGS+= --with-html-dir=${PREFIX}/share/doc/html
+CONFIGURE_ARGS+= --with-html-dir=${DESTDIR}${PREFIX}/share/doc/html
PKGCONFIG_OVERRIDE= ${WRKSRC}/gdome2.pc.in
.include "../../devel/glib2/buildlink3.mk"
Home |
Main Index |
Thread Index |
Old Index